I have had a fetish for '69-70 Chevrolet C10 pickups my whole life and have owned several '67-72 models. I had a very clean '69 to build and restore when we moved 5 years ago, but sold it in 2020 to finance finishing the inside of the bare pole building into a heated shop. I bought 2 '67's a couple years ago, but just can't get into that front end like I do the '69-70 model. So.... Monday I left home at 4pm and drove straight thru the night to Mannford OK to buy another abandoned '69 mutt to build into a driver. I did stop and take a 3 hour nap in Iola, KS, so it wasn't entirely non-stop. I got to the location at 8:45 am Tuesday and looked the truck over and made an offer less than he wanted, but he accepted, since it wasn't quite as clean as advertised. I called my wife and told her I was loaded up and would be heading home. That's when she asked if I had checked the weather for Tuesday and Wednesday and I said I hadn't...why ? apparently, I had missed seeing a warning about a blizzard set to hit the entire length of I 35 from KC to home...
